Apple to pay compensation for slowing down older iPhones!
Tech giant Apple has begun paying $500 million in compensation in the US for intentionally slowing down certain iPhone models.
Apple has decided to pay $500 million in compensation in a class-action lawsuit filed in the US for intentionally slowing down certain iPhone models.
In the long-running case, it was acknowledged that Apple had intentionally reduced the performance of the phones in question over time. Accused of slowing down phones without informing customers about this situation, Apple had offered discounted battery replacements to customers to resolve the issue.
With the payment of the $500 million settlement, Apple will pay $92 in compensation to customers who claimed their phones were slowed down. The case in the US, which Apple sought to settle in 2020, dates back to 2017.
A similar lawsuit is ongoing in the UK, with a compensation claim of 1.6 billion pounds. In the UK case, it is alleged that Apple similarly intentionally reduced the performance of iPhones. Apple, however, denies these allegations and maintains that its products were not intentionally slowed down.
